    FabMo is a wonderful community resource that I wish more people knew about. Run by a cadre of…read moremostly women volunteers, this organization rescues discontinued samples from upscale design showrooms in San Francisco. Housed in a small Sunnyvale warehouse, the organization says that each year, they keep about 70 tons (!) of material from going to the landfill. FabMo hosts regular sales open to the public as well as biannual "free giveaway" events. Customers can find tile, carpet, textile fabrics, wallpaper and more. Many materials are provided for free to teachers and there are also donations from the local community. Quilting fabrics, silk fabrics, jewelry making items, sewing notions, leather, decorations and much, much more are offered for sale in person or online through the FabMo eBay store.
